What a difference a day, and sunshine, makes

The rainy weather yesterday left me a painful, sleepy wreck … but today, the sun came out, literally.

I woke up this morning with a little more energy (and when I say “wake up,” I mean coffee, stretching, and medicine are already in motion) than yesterday.  For a few reasons, I think, yesterday morning was a train wreck.

I woke up yesterday extremely fatigued and sore (more than my usual Fibromyalgia/Myofascial Pain Syndrome self).  The muscles in my left thigh were so sore I wanted to rip my leg off (my fictional go-to way of getting rid of the problem).  It was rainy outside, so that no doubt contributed to it. I was so bummed because my son got some new outdoor toys for his birthday and I wanted to go outside with him and check them out.  Instead, I laid on the couch with a pillow and blanket, barely able to stay awake to keep an eye on him while he played inside.

I ended up convincing my son to lay in bed with me and watch a movie. I fell asleep … he jumped all over and under the blankets, and tackled the dog a few times. But needless to say, I was able to get some rest.

A fruit and veggie smoothie also helped, as did lots of water. At least I optimistically think they helped.

I also then realized that I forgot to take my medicine in the morning. Oops!  No wonder I had such a rough morning.

The afternoon was much better, after I took my medicine and the sun came out (Cue the music … “I can see clearly now, the rain is gone …” ). But all in all, the day was mostly a sleepy, painful train wreck.

Today I had more energy throughout the day, and kept up with errands including taking my 4-year-old son to his well-check doctor appointment (shots, yikes), and shopping with him at Target.

I did, however, have to head home at that point. Can’t get too crazy!  The fruit market will have to wait until tomorrow, which hopefully will also be a better day.

P.S. I was able to do some exercises with my foam roller and a little yoga outside tonight on my deck. Felt great.
